Output e3a0b268d40f34c941091036ad6b37048696d0462b313113e01a1d8659e5e74f:5

value
154569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17a52605ce6838aa423c8275fe9cae66cd82bd37 OP_EQUAL
address
33r3JgCNnTBJNGFutEru66xWV3Hd2BE2hq
transaction
e3a0b268d40f34c941091036ad6b37048696d0462b313113e01a1d8659e5e74f
spent
true